Purpose - RafStar K9

Produced/Edited by Raf Fontan

Filmed using a mobile rig, post-production/editing done with Adobe Premiere Pro. 

At it's core this documentary is about purpose and how the bond between a person and a shelter dog can change the course of a life. It follows one man's journey, that began with the adoption of a single puppy and grew into a nationwide mission to support shelter animals. Even after the dog's passing, the impact of that relationship continues through ongoing animal welfare work, demonstrating how one connection can create lasting change for countless dogs in need. 

Saving Lives: A Polk County Bully Project

Produced/Directed/Edited by Raf Fontan

Filmed using a Sony FX6, professional lighting package and boom microphone. Post-production/editing done with Adobe Premiere Pro. 

Saving Lives explores the profound impact that a small idea can have within a community where every life matters. The documentary follows the journey of two best friends who recognized a critical need in their hometown and were compelled to take action. What began as shared passion evolved into a mission dedicated to rescuing and advocating for bully-breed type dogs, demonstrating how commitment, compassion, and perseverance can create a meaningful change in the lives of both animals and the people who care for them.
